The cause of a car wreck that occured monday afternoon has still not been determined. What is known is that patrol officers with the WSPD responded to a vehicle collision at the intersection of Grandview Club Road and Rock Hill Road at approximately 3:57pm.
The preliminary investigation revealed that a Honda Civic, operated by 17 year-old Julia Nicole Guarantano was traveling eastbound on Rock Hill Road and a Jeep Cherokee operated by 68 year-old William Virgil Brewer Jr. was traveling southbound on Grandview Club Road. The collision occurred in the intersection of the two roadways. The cause of this collision is still being investigated. he 3500 and 3600 blocks of Grandview Club Road were closed for approximately 4 hours, because of the wreck. A detour was utilized to assist the citizens that needed to travel in this area during the time the roadway was closed.
Ms. Guarantano is being treated at WFU Baptist Hospital for serious injuries. Mr. Brewer is being treated at Forsyth Medical Center for non-life threatening injuries.
